The InterContinental Hotels Group® properties in Dubai Festival City consist of four hotel brands. These include the luxury brand InterContinental, the superior upscale Crowne Plaza, the lavish long-stay InterContinental Residence Suites and the vibrant mid-scale Holiday Inn. In addition to over 1000+ bedrooms, the four properties boast a selection of high quality restaurants and bars, an impressive 3,800 square meter Event Centre across two levels, the 5,000 square meters Festival Arena by InterContinental, the luxurious Spa InterContinental, state-of-the-art gymnasium and swimming pool facilities. Responsibilities: Prepare and present a variety of cold dishes, including pâtés, terrines, salads, appetisers, charcuterie, sandwiches, canapés, and garnishes. Ensure all dishes are prepared to the highest quality and presentation standards. Collaborate with the executive chef and other kitchen staff to develop and update the cold kitchen menu. Create new and innovative cold dishes to enhance the menu offerings. Monitor and manage inventory levels of cold kitchen ingredients and supplies. Order and stock ingredients as needed to ensure smooth operation. Adhere to all food safety and hygiene regulations and standards. Ensure that all ingredients are stored and handled properly to prevent contamination. Maintain consistency in the quality and presentation of cold dishes. Perform regular quality checks to ensure dishes meet the establishment’s standards. Train and supervise junior kitchen staff and interns in the cold kitchen. Provide guidance and support to ensure the team’s efficiency and effectiveness. Monitor and control food costs in the cold kitchen. Minimise waste and ensure efficient use of ingredients. Plan staff rostering and holidays in advance. Follow recipes and standard operating procedures accurately.
